L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Unplug the kegerator and drain any liquid. Remove tap assemblies and wipe faucets, lines, and couplers with a food-safe sanitizer to remove bacteria and yeast. Clean interior surfaces with mild detergent and warm water; rinse and dry thoroughly. Vacuum condenser coils monthly to improve efficiency and lower utility bills. Degrease vents and check seals for wear; replace if damaged. Professional setup is recommended for built-in applications.#@@#Maintenance Guide#@#Inspect seals monthly; replace any with cracks or gaps to maintain temperatures. Clean condenser coils every three months: unplug, brush debris, and vacuum fins for airflow. Drain and sanitize drip trays weekly with mild detergent; rinse thoroughly. Check keg connections and faucets before each shift; tighten fittings and purge lines to prevent contamination. Verify voltage and amperage at installation; ensure 115v and 1.2 amp supply on a dedicated circuit.
